&lt;p&gt; That would have to be the time I went canoeing on the Buffalo River in Tennessee with the Outing Society which I belonged to in college (Spring of 1979). I can&amp;#39;t remember if it rained while we camped overnight, or if it had been raining a lot before our trip, but on the 2nd day of paddling on the river, all of a sudden we came upon a very very fast and high section of water, and a tree was down over the river, and somehow most of us capsized. A couple of us landed on the far shore, and had to find a way back across, which eventually involved jumping in and swimming for our lives across the raging current. It was quite frightening at the time.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;We did get all the canoes back on to shore (I think they got caught on some branches and so on, and some of the guys were able to rescue them), and most of the gear was salvaged from the river where it got shallower, but I never did recover the sleeping bag I had recently sewn myself from a Frostline kit (remember them?). [Frankly, I can&amp;#39;t remember what I slept in the rest of the trip - I think someone must&amp;#39;ve loaned me their bag and one of the couples shared.]&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;That was it for the canoeing portion of our Spring Break then - after we were all safely on shore, we built a fire and dried out some, then hiked to where we saw a barn, and most of us stayed there while some of the others hiked out for help and transportation. (Remember this was long before cell phones.) For the rest of the week we drove to the mountains and just camped by a pretty little lake, so it still turned out to be a fun trip - but could&amp;#39;ve very easily been disastrous. I know now that we were attempting to do something beyond our skill level, never a good idea; really dumb, in fact. &lt;p&gt; Well, the cool thing is that most of the things you can do to conserve the planet&amp;#39;s resources... also save you money! Bonus! Here are some things I do:&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Avoid disposable cleaning items (paper towels, Swiffer-type single-use junk, etc - cut-up old clothes are free)&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Avoid excess packaging (single-serve food items, individually wrapped anything - always more expensive)&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Turn down the thermostat and put on a sweatshirt&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Use the least amount and lowest temperature of water to do the job&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Re-use the backs of letters (including junk mail) instead of buying note-pads&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Go to the library instead of buying books (most of the time anyway)&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Stay out of stores and&amp;#160;don&amp;#39;t look at catalogs, unless I actually &lt;em&gt;need &lt;/em&gt;something (as in, the old one fell apart and can&amp;#39;t be mended)&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Drive a hybrid!&l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Here are some ways I &lt;em&gt;don&amp;#39;t&lt;/em&gt; save money:&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Spend $4 on a cappuccino almost daily (although I do at least bring my own cup... does that count?)&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Buy organic foods (but I know it&amp;#39;s better for me, my family, and the planet, so I don&amp;#39;t mind spending extra here - also don&amp;#39;t get me started on the &lt;em&gt;societal &lt;/em&gt;cost of cheap fatty manufactured food vs its price to the consumer)&l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;    &lt;p style=&quot;clear:both;&quot;&gt;

&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;I&amp;#39;ve driven a &lt;a href=&quot;http://sandyu.vox.com/library/post/a-couple-of-milestones.html&quot;&gt;Honda Civic Hybrid&lt;/a&gt;&amp;#160;for the past 4 years (people are probably sick of hearing about it, but I love my little car)&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;We compost vegetable scraps&amp;#160;/&amp;#160;leaves etc&amp;#160;(have been doing this since I was a kid - it means we have luscious gardens with no chemical fertilizers, meaning we can actually eat what comes out of them)&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;We recycle everything possible (also been doing this since childhood - yay for Mom!).&amp;#160;Reuse or try not to purchase anything &lt;em&gt;not&lt;/em&gt; recyclable -- sometimes this is hard to accomplish, and we still do end up with almost a full bag of garbage at the curb each week :-(&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;I use my pile of canvas bags when shopping -- I&amp;#39;m pretty sure I&amp;#39;m the only one who shops at our local grocery store who does this, which is a shame. &l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;We do our best to conserve gas/electricity/water. For us this means motion sensors on a number of room lights, compact flourescent bulbs where feasible, high efficiency furnace, low-water-usage washer &amp;amp; dishwasher (both Fisher &amp;amp; Paykel)&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;I try to buy organic / local foods whenever possible, which ironically is rather difficult in this rural community. BUT, this season I discovered a local organic farm which has subscription weekly food deliveries, so I signed us right up -- we got our first little &amp;quot;winter&amp;quot; box a week ago: stored beets, carrots, potatoes, and fresh spring greens. I can&amp;#39;t wait till the real growing season starts!&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;We try to be good corporate citizens as well... when we built our &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.castconstone.com/NewPlant.shtml&quot;&gt;new manufacturing plant &lt;/a&gt;and office space 4 years ago, we opted for a &amp;quot;green&amp;quot; building (Silver LEED rating), mostly meaning recycled materials and high-efficiency lighting and heating (for example motion sensors in various office spaces, and heating and lighting such that we&amp;#39;re consuming the same amount of gas and electricity as the old facility but with triple the production capacity and many more pieces of heavy equipment). Also, a portion of the electricity we purchase is from a local wind farm.&l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;
&lt;p&gt;All this is not meant as bragging, it&amp;#39;s just an issue that I&amp;#39;m pretty passionate about. [My daughter calls me a hippie and my husband calls me an eco-freak, but I assume those are meant as compliments!]&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;But I know I could do more, like air dry my clothes rather than use the dryer,&amp;#160;not use the computer/electronics/microwave so much, drive less, try harder to buy even less stuff than I do, etc.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;I&amp;#160;do try to walk softly on this earth, but there are many aspects of today&amp;#39;s society which make it difficult. All we &lt;del&gt;can&lt;/del&gt; must do is keep trying.&lt;/p&gt;    &lt;p style=&quot;clear:both;&quot;&gt;
